French Country Interior Design Ideas
French Country interior design, also known as farmhouse chic, brings a rustic charm with a touch of elegance to any space. It exudes a sense of warmth, comfort, and timelessness, making it a popular choice for homeowners seeking a welcoming and inviting atmosphere. This style draws inspiration from the rural countryside of France, incorporating natural materials, vintage pieces, and soft color palettes to create a beautifully understated aesthetic.
Embrace Natural Textures and Materials
Natural elements are key to achieving the French Country look. Incorporate wood, stone, and linen in your design to create a connection to the outdoors. Wood beams on ceilings or exposed wooden floorboards add rustic charm, while stone fireplaces or accent walls bring a touch of earthy elegance. Linen fabrics are a staple in French Country interiors, used for curtains, bedding, and upholstery. Their soft texture and natural fibers contribute to the relaxed and inviting ambiance. Natural textures like woven baskets, terracotta pots, and antique rugs further enhance the rustic charm of the space.
Create a Warm and Inviting Color Palette
French Country interiors are characterized by a soothing and muted color palette. Opt for neutral shades of white, cream, beige, and gray as the foundation for your space. You can introduce pops of color with warm tones like terracotta, olive green, and pale blue. These hues add a sense of vibrancy and life to the overall design. Avoid overly saturated or bright colors, as they can clash with the rustic aesthetic. Instead, use these hues in accents like throw pillows, artwork, or floral arrangements.
Incorporate Vintage and Antique Pieces
One of the hallmarks of French Country style is the use of vintage and antique furniture and decor. These pieces tell stories and add character to the space, making it feel lived-in and cherished. Look for distressed wood furniture, antique mirrors, and vintage lighting. You can find unique finds at flea markets, antique stores, and online marketplaces. Don't be afraid to mix and match different eras and styles to create a curated and eclectic look. A vintage French armoire can serve as a statement piece in the living room, while antique chairs can add rustic charm to the dining area.
Embrace Simplicity and Functionality
French Country design emphasizes simplicity and functionality. Avoid clutter and keep the overall design clean and uncluttered. Focus on functionality and choose pieces that serve a purpose. For example, a farmhouse table with distressed wood can be used for dining, working, or gathering. While decorative elements are essential, they should be chosen thoughtfully and used sparingly. This approach helps maintain the feeling of calm and serenity that is so characteristic of French Country interiors.
Add Personal Touches with Floral Accents
Floral accents are a beautiful way to bring life and color to French Country interiors. Include fresh flowers in vases, dried floral arrangements, or botanical prints on walls. Choose floral arrangements that reflect the natural beauty of the countryside, such as wildflowers, roses, or lavender. These elements add a touch of romanticism and charm to the space, reflecting the beauty of the French countryside.
Embrace Imperfection and Distressed Finishes
French Country aesthetic embraces imperfections and distressed finishes. Don't shy away from chipped paint, weathered wood, or worn leather. These marks of time add character and authenticity to the space. A distressed coffee table with chipped paint adds rustic charm, while an aged leather armchair creates a sense of comfort and history. Embrace the unique patina of antique pieces, as they contribute to the overall charm of the design.
Elevate the Look with Soft Lighting
Soft lighting is crucial for creating a warm and inviting ambiance in French Country interiors. Combine natural light with warm, soft lighting from lamps, lanterns, and candles. Use dimmer switches to control the intensity of the light and create a cozy atmosphere. Chandeliers with crystal accents or wrought iron lanterns can add a touch of elegance to the space. The soft glow of candlelight creates a romantic and inviting ambiance, perfect for creating a cozy atmosphere for evenings spent at home.
